Picture yourself diving alongside the largest fish on the PLANET, the whale shark. Embark on a serene journey in the waters around Holbox Island. We’ll journey into the ocean for about an hour in search of this gentle creature for an amazing snorkeling experience. Throughout our voyage, you might also spot dolphins, turtles, and the awe-inspiring giant manta ray. Following this, we’ll chart a course to another nature reserve, Cabo Catoche, situated at the farthest point of our stunning island where the Gulf of Mexico and the Caribbean Sea meet. Here, we’ll do a second snorkel session on a reef. With a stroke of good fortune, we might see manta rays, turtles, cat sharks, seahorses, starfish, vibrant fish, and other aquatic species.
